TH17 cells promote microbial killing and innate immune sensing of DNA via interleukin 26 #MMPMID26168081
Meller S; Domizio JD; Voo KS; Friedrich HC; Chamilos G; Ganguly D; Conrad C; Gregorio J; Roy DL; Roger T; Ladbury JE; Homey B; Watowich S; Modlin RL; Kontoyiannis DP; Liu YJ; Arold ST; Gilliet M
Nat Immunol 2015[Sep]; 16 (9): 970-9 PMID26168081show ga
Interleukin 17?producing helper T cells (TH17 cells) have a major role in protection against infections and in mediating autoimmune diseases, yet the mechanisms involved are incompletely understood. We found that interleukin 26 (IL-26), a human TH17 cell?derived cytokine, is a cationic amphipathic protein that kills extracellular bacteria via membrane-pore formation. Furthermore, TH17 cell?derived IL-26 formed complexes with bacterial DNA and self-DNA released by dying bacteria and host cells. The resulting IL-26?DNA complexes triggered the production of type I interferon by plasmacytoid dendritic cells via activation of Toll-like receptor 9, but independently of the IL-26 receptor. These findings provide insights into the potent antimicrobial and proinflammatory function of TH17 cells by showing that IL-26 is a natural human antimicrobial that promotes immune sensing of bacterial and host cell death.
